Recognizing Cataracts and Their Effect On Vision



Comprehending cataracts and their influence on vision is necessary for any individual experiencing this condition. Cataracts happen when the natural lens in your eye becomes clouded, causing fuzzy or hazy vision. This can make it hard to see plainly and can have a considerable effect on your day-to-day live. As cataracts progress, you may also experience difficulty seeing in low light problems and see a raised sensitivity to glare. These signs can make it tougher to read, drive, or even identify faces. Checking Out the current Surgical Techniques



Discover the innovative strategies in cataract surgical procedure that are reinventing the area, while taking advantage of an incredible 98% success price.

Among the latest developments is the use of femtosecond lasers, which permits exact cuts and decreases the threat of difficulties. This modern technology creates a 3D image of the eye, allowing doctors to customize the surgical procedure to every client's unique needs.

One more method gaining popularity is using intraocular lenses (IOLs) that can remedy both cataracts as well as refractive errors, such as nearsightedness or astigmatism. please click the next document advanced IOLs supply better vision top quality, lowering the demand for glasses or call lenses post-surgery.

In addition, specialists are now using smaller cuts and more advanced phacoemulsification devices, causing faster healing times and minimal pain.

Considering the Perks and also Dangers of Cataract Surgery



Considering the benefits and threats of cataract surgical treatment, it's important to consider the potential life-changing outcomes against any prospective issues.

Cataract surgery has actually developed significantly, offering various advantages to patients. One significant advantage is boosted vision, as the gloomy lens is changed with a clear synthetic one. This can greatly improve your capacity to perform daily activities, such as reading, driving, as well as enjoying hobbies. Additionally, cataract surgical procedure has a high success rate, with a lot of patients experiencing improved vision shortly after the treatment.

Nevertheless, like any type of surgical procedure, there are risks included. These can consist of infection, bleeding, and even a momentary increase in eye pressure. It's essential to go over these possible threats with your surgeon as well as make a notified choice based on your specific scenarios.
